Overview
Based on quantum cascade laser technology, it is possible to monitor and identify chemical harmful gases in space at distances of hundreds or even thousands of kilometers in real time, and accurately detect mixtures with extremely low false alarm rates. The wide tuning hyperspectral gas wide range rapid scanning early warning system is widely used for chemical agents (chemical gas monitoring in airports, subways, buildings, etc.), gas leakage monitoring in chemical industrial parks, and gas pipeline leakage monitoring.

Wide tuning hyperspectral gas wide range rapid scanning warning systemAdvantage:

Can simultaneously detect over 200 types of chemical gases, equipped with infrared absorption spectra of over 260 substances, and support self built spectral libraries

Low detection limit, with some gases reaching ppb level, particularly sensitive to chemical agents (CWA)

The monitoring range is wide, covering tens of thousands of square meters of space. By installing reflectors, the detection coverage area can be expanded

● Contactless measurement with extremely low false alarm rate

Adopting algorithms to ensure accurate detection results

● Good integration, open interface protocol, can be integrated with existing detection equipment into the monitoring platform

● Easy to operate, no consumables or consumables, low maintenance costs

● Flexible arrangement, enabling rapid monitoring and deployment

Application Scenario:

● Monitoring of factory boundaries in chemical industrial parks

Gas leakage monitoring in hazardous material storage areas

Gas leakage monitoring for natural gas processing, petrochemical production, storage and transportation processes

Chemical gas monitoring in airports, subways, ports, and other places
